Abstract

To provide a method of manufacturing a quartz-crystal resonator, in which without adding new processes, a desired quartz-crystal piece can be obtained from a quartz-crystal wafer by etching and electrodes can be provided without restraint. When a quartz-crystal pieceis formed, etching maskshaving dummy regionsthat are provided at two positions corresponding to corner portions on a +X side of the quartz-crystal pieceand extend toward a +X axis direction of a wafer W are formed, and when the quartz-crystal pieceis formed, etching in groove portionsat positions corresponding to the dummy regionsis delayed. Accordingly, it is possible to form the quartz-crystal piecewithout chipped portions at the corner portions in a state where the quartz-crystal pieceand the wafer W are connected to and supported by a connection support portion
